Brighton i360 is a 162 m (531 ft) observation tower on the seafront of Brighton, East Sussex, England at the landward end of the remains of the West Pier.

The 162-meter (531-foot) British Airways i360, which opens to the public on August 4, is the world’s tallest moving observation tower and also its Guinness record breaking slimmest thanks to a diameter of 3.9 meters (12.8 feet) and a height-to-width ratio of over 40:1.

The British Airways i360, also known as the Brighton i360, is a 162m tall observation tower on the seafront at Brighton. The tower has a moving observation pod which slides up and down the structure. The pod can take up to 200 passengers at a time. A return journey – known as a flight – takes 20 minutes.

British Airways i360 is a 162 metre tall tower with a fully enclosed glass observation pod that gently lifts 200 passengers to 138 metres, offering 360-degree views of Brighton and the English Channel. The purpose of the attraction is to delight, entertain and inspire whilst acting as a catalyst for regeneration.

First, you will experience a flight on the BA i360 pod to its full height of 138 metres before entering the i360 tower through a hatch – previously never open to the public. A 24-metre climb via a series of ladders and platforms leads you to the top of the tower.
